Linux不仅是一个操作系统,更是一种文化和哲学,它鼓励用户深入探索、定制与优化
在这个过程中,“打开Options”(即开启各种配置选项)成为了通往Linux无限潜能的关键之门
本文将深入探讨Linux系统中的“打开Options”,展示如何通过合理配置,让Linux系统更加贴合个人或企业的需求,实现性能优化、安全加固、功能扩展等多方面的提升
一、理解Linux的配置哲学 Linux的强大之处在于其高度的可配置性
与许多闭源操作系统不同,Linux允许用户直接访问并修改系统的核心设置,从内核参数到用户空间的应用程序配置,几乎每一层面都可以进行精细调整
这种设计哲学使得Linux能够灵活适应从嵌入式设备到超级计算机的各种应用场景
“打开Options”的过程,本质上是对Linux系统进行定制化的过程
这包括但不限于: - 内核编译选项:通过编译自定义内核,选择性地启用或禁用内核功能,以满足特定硬件或性能需求
- 系统服务管理:利用systemd或其他服务管理工具,启用或禁用系统服务,优化系统资源使用
- 软件包管理:通过包管理器(如apt、yum、dnf等)安装、升级或卸载软件包,扩展系统功能
- 配置文件编辑:直接编辑配置文件(如/etc目录下的各种配置文件),调整系统行为和网络设置等
二、性能优化:释放硬件潜能 性能优化是Linux系统管理中极为重要的一环
通过合理开启和调整相关选项,可以显著提升系统响应速度、减少资源占用,确保系统在高负载下依然稳定运行
1.内核调优: -调度器选择:根据工作负载类型(如服务器、桌面、实时系统等),选择合适的CPU调度器
-内存管理:调整内存分配策略,如启用内存压缩(ksm)、内存去重(zram)等,以应对内存紧张的情况
-网络优化:开启TCP Fast Open、调整TCP连接超时时间等,提高网络传输效率
2.系统服务优化: -禁用不必要的服务:减少系统启动时的服务加载,降低资源消耗
-使用systemd定时器:按需启动服务,而非始终运行,以节省资源
3.硬件加速: -启用GPU加速:对于图形密集型应用,确保已安装并启用相应的GPU驱动和加速库(如NVIDIA驱动、Vulkan等)
-SSD优化:调整文件系统挂载选项(如`noatime`、`nodiratime`),减少SSD写入次数,延长寿命
三、安全加固:构建坚不可摧的防线 安全性是任何系统不可忽视的核心要素
Linux通过丰富的安全选项,为用户提供了强大的安全保护机制
1.内核安全特性: -ASLR(地址空间布局随机化):防止恶意软件预测内存地址,提高攻击难度
-SECCOMP:在进程级别实施安全策略,限制进程能执行的系统调用
2.防火墙与入侵检测: -iptables/firewalld:配置防火墙规则,控制进出系统的网络流量
-SELinux/AppArmor:实施强制访问控制,限制程序权限,防止权限提升攻击
3.安全更新与补丁管理: -启用自动更新:确保系统及时获得安全补丁,减少漏洞暴露时间
-使用签名验证:下载和安装软件包时,验证签名以确保软件来源的可靠性
四、功能扩展:满足多样化需求 Linux的模块化设计使其能够轻松扩展功能,满足从个人娱乐到企业级应用的各种需求
1.桌面环境定制: -GNOME、KDE等桌面环境:通过主题、图标集、扩展插件等方式,个性化定制桌面界面
-Wayland与Xorg:选择适合的显示服务器,优化图形性能或兼容性
2.开发工具与语言支持: -编译器与解释器:安装GCC、Clang、Python、Ruby等,支持多种编程语言的开发
-IDE与编辑器:如VSCode、Eclipse、Vim等,提供强大的代码编辑与调试功能
3.服务器应用: -Web服务器:Nginx、Apache等,高效处理HTTP请求,支持SSL/TLS加密
-数据库:MySQL、PostgreSQL、MongoDB等,满足不同类型数据存储与查询需求
-容器技术:Docker、Kubernetes等,实现应用的轻量级部署与管理
五、结论:持续探索,无限可能 Linux的“打开Options”不仅仅是对配置的简单调整,它代表着一种探索精神,鼓励用户不断挖掘系统的潜力,追求更高效、更安全、更个性化的使用体验
随着技术的不断进步,Linux社区也在持续贡献新的特性和工具,使得这一操作系统的边界不断被拓宽
对于每一位Linux用户而言,无论是初学者还是资深专家,掌握“打开Options”的艺术,意味着能够更好地驾驭这一强大的操作系统,将其打造成为满足自己特定需求的理想平台
在这个过程中,不断学习、实践与交流,将是你不断进步的阶梯
总之,Linux的世界是开放而广阔的,每一次“打开Options”的尝试,都可能开启一段全新的旅程,带你领略操作系统的无限魅力
让我们携手前行,在Linux的海洋中,探索未知,创造未来